Dubai has a variety of transportation options, including the metro, bus, taxi, tram, and water taxis. You can also rent a car or use ride-hailing apps. - The Dubai Metro is the world's longest driverless metro system.
- It has multiple stops and connects to many of the city's top attractions.
- You can use a rechargeable Nol card to save money.
- The Dubai Bus network covers a large area of the city.
- It's a cost-effective way to get around.
- Taxis are available throughout the city and are a common way to get around.
- You can flag them down on the street or use a phone app.
- Some taxis are driven by women and have pink roofs.
- The Dubai Tram connects the Dubai Metro and the Palm Monorail.
- It's a convenient way to get around the JBR district and Palm Jumeirah.
- You can use a water taxi to get around Dubai.
- The Creek is a port area where traditional boats ferry people.
- You can use ride-hailing apps like Uber or Careem to get around Dubai.
- You can rent a car to explore more of the country's sights.
